Description
Lovelle is pleased to welcome you to 5 Holly Close - a beautifully kept three-bedroom detached home that combines generous space, a neutral decor palette and a convenient village setting. Set back behind a neat, gravelled frontage with driveway and garage, the property immediately impresses with its smart brick façade, dormer-style windows and uPVC front entrance door.
Step inside and you'll find light-filled, carefully considered living space. A full-length lounge enjoys garden views through wide sliding doors, while the sociable kitchen-diner offers excellent storage, practical work surfaces and plenty of room for family dining or entertaining friends. Upstairs, two well-proportioned double bedrooms sit alongside a versatile third bedroom that works equally well as a nursery, study or dressing room. The modern family bathroom features eye-catching mosaic tiling, a mosaic tiled bath and an over-bath shower for everyday convenience.
Outside, the south-facing rear garden is a real highlight - mainly laid to lawn and edged with a gravelled seating terrace, it provides the perfect backdrop for children to play or for summer barbecues. To one corner stands a smart timber studio/workshop that could be easily transformed into a well-insulated home office, hobby room or teen den.
All of this lies within easy reach of Cherry Willingham's shops, cafes, medical centre and highly regarded primary and secondary schools, while Lincoln city centre is just a short drive or bus journey away. In short, 5 Holly Close delivers move-in-ready comfort, flexible space and a superb village setting - an ideal next step for a young family or professional couple seeking modern living with room to grow.
